ASPECTS REGARDING THE RISK OF EXPLOSION IN DEDUSTING SYSTEMS

(STEF92 Technology, 2023-10-01, Mirela Ancuta Radu, Mihaela Părăian, Dan Matei, Adrian Jurca, Dan Gabor)

Show more

The removal and collection of dust particles from the air discharged into the atmosphere by industrial plants processing, transporting and storing dusty materials is an important objective for employers to prevent air pollution according to environmental legislation and employee safety regulations. Where the dust in question is flammable and may generate an explosive atmosphere, measures must be taken to prevent explosion and/or limit the effects of explosion. THE RISK OF INITIATING EXPLOSIVE ATMOSPHERES BY ELECTROSTATIC DISCHARGES FROM MATERIALS AND TECHNICAL EQUIPMENT USED IN INSTALLATIONS WHERE HYDROGEN IS PRESENT

(STEF92 Technology, 2023-10-01, Florin Păun, A. Olariu-Jurca, Mihaela Părăian, Mihai Cătălin Popa, Anca Tăzlăuanu)

Show more

Materials and technical equipment, especially their external parts, are inherently subjected to the electrification process during their use. The electrification process of the materials and external parts of the equipment, especially the non-conductive ones, is responsible for the generation, through specific mechanisms, of significant amounts of electrostatic charges.
